The New York Times daily crossword is the standard the whole hobby measures itself against, and it is entirely behind a paywall: today's puzzle, the archive, all of it needs a NYT Games or All Access subscription. The free part of NYT Games is the Mini.
The Daily Crossword here is a standard 15×15 American-style grid — symmetric black squares, fully checked, numbered across and down — served fresh every day and free to solve in your browser. It is the same daily puzzle the Daily Crosswords & Word Games iPhone app serves.

Honest differences
The NYT crossword is edited by a full-time team and constructed by hundreds of contributors, with themes, rebus squares and Thursday trickery that reward years of solving. If that is what you want, nothing else is quite it.
The Daily Crossword aims at something different: a clean, fair, full-size grid you can actually finish over lunch, every single day, without wondering whether your subscription renewed. Clues are direct, the difficulty stays roughly level through the week, and there are no gimmicks to decode before you can start filling.
